Present: G. Halloran (chair), M. Reyes, T. Abercorn, F. Dunleavy.

The committee reviewed the proposed switch from Kestrel Freight to Bramwell Logistics. Bramwell's tender offers a 9% cost reduction and next-day coverage across the Norwood corridor, though onboarding will take eight weeks. Kestrel's contract expires in June; notice must be served by April. M. Reyes will lead the transition workstream and report fortnightly. For the incoming director, the committee recorded the following confidential context.

board note of kageg-bahof: The renewal with Holwynax Holdings closes at $2 million a year, 5 percent below the last contract. Project Ulaath slips by two quarters because of the supplier delay.

## Deployment

The Harrowfield telemetry gateway ships as a single binary. Deploy via the orchard pipeline; never copy binaries by hand to field units. Each gateway buffers tractor and irrigation telemetry locally and flushes when uplink returns. After deploy, confirm the buffer directory mounted read-write and the uplink check passes within five minutes. Rollback is a redeploy of the previous tag — state is forward-compatible. The gateway reads the following configuration values at startup:

service settings:
[casax]
port = 6379
team = rusir
host = casax.zemvarhq.corp
region = outer-4
access_code = ac_9808ce
timeout_ms = 1500

This page covers the delivery of the hardware security module from Veldane Systems to the Corran Street data room. The unit travels in a tamper-evident case and must remain in dual custody from collection to installation. Dispatch logs the seal number at pick-up and again on arrival; any mismatch halts the delivery and triggers an incident report. The case is never left unattended in the vehicle, and no intermediate stops are permitted. The courier hand-over instruction for this delivery is stated below.

handover note for yagef-bagep: the drudor pelius courier leaves the kasdor zorvan norir ledger at gate 8016 under passcode 755406